Hi guys,

I have a strange behaviour with my high sierra recovery partition, the sistem start and work perfectly but if i boot from recovery partition the system stuck on apple logo

i have try to change the config.plist and the recovery start perfectly .... how can i discover the problem on the original config.plist file ??

If it boots up regularly then its not the config.plist thats stopping the recovery partition from booting

 

Do you connect to the internet using Wifi? It could be that the recovery partition tries to download something from the internet, but since there is no active connection it cannot. If that is the case, you could try to hook it up thru ethernet and see if that works.
